In Lesley Glaister's spellbinding outback thriller, a young couple's flight from a cold and dreary English winter traps them in a sunbaked nightmare
For Cassie, the ad in the newspaper is a dream come true. Spending a year managing a farm in western Australia away from everything and everyone she and her commitment-phobic boyfriend, Graham, know could be exactly what he needs to realize it's time to think about getting married and starting a family.
But their fantasy adventure isn't quite what Cassie imagined. Woolagong, an old sheep station, is on the remote fringes of the desert, where the weather is stifling hot all the time. And the outback is crawling with all manner of lethal creatures. There's no telephone, no radio, and no electricityβno contact with the outside world. Cassie and Graham send letters home but never receive any in return.
And then there are the employers. Larry and his wife, Mara, live a very private life,...
